Output 63851d29d6a788609c56c5a6fa974a1333886f13f3b1d752dc88c95ceda89d80:0

value
784741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 843162e198bef6e7a253417b1a65c9d404320e88 OP_EQUAL
address
3DjzHHLd5gUfA1CXeyRu3cLAgK455hQ4CV
transaction
63851d29d6a788609c56c5a6fa974a1333886f13f3b1d752dc88c95ceda89d80
spent
true